Yellowstone Bank is pleased to bring a full array of highly competitive products and services to the communities we serve. Drawing on more than 100 years of banking experience, Yellowstone Bank has achieved a strong and growing presence in the financial services marketplace. Yellowstone Bank was founded by B. M. Harris in 1907 and today, after five generations, is still owned and operated by the Harris family. Bank management and staff are committed to maintaining Yellowstone Bank's exceptional level of customer service, stability and financial strength. In an era characterized by industry-wide mergers and consolidation, Yellowstone Bank is proud to remain an independent community bank with decisions made promptly by people who live in the communities they serve. Our prominence as an active commercial, agricultural and real estate lender has grown along with the success of our customers. Yellowstone Bank takes pride in contributing to the economic growth evident within our communities.

It's hard to believe it’s been nearly 70 years since 9 Montana refinery workers pooled their money in a cash box located in an empty box car. It's equally as hard to imagine they could have envisioned the impact they would have on the lives of so many people. The first loan given was used to purchase a sewing machine. The rest, as they say, is history. Thanks to their leap of faith so many years ago, we're here today. Altana Federal Credit Union – Laurel Federal Credit Union, at the time – has grown to support people and families who live, work and worship in seven counties in Montana. Today, we help people build their dream home, purchase their first vehicle, and save for college or retirement. What hasn’t changed over the last 60 years is the cooperative spirit that was the cornerstone of that first meeting. Their vision and philosophy - a desire to promote thrift and savings in an effort to improve the financial lives of members and their families - is alive and well. We believe the growth and well-being of our communities will continue to remain bright as long as people continue to hold sacred this spirit of cooperation. Federally insured by NCUA.
